These Ubangi women imported by circus promoters and shown in sideshows in Europe and the United States had a tradition of enlarging their lower lips by inserting progressively larger wooden disks into a slit made shortly after birth. This highly unusual adornment (at least by Western standards), gave them an exotic air. The photo at left heightens their differences by posing them next to their Western female counterparts. The enlarged lip was such a prominent feature of these tribeswomen that their personal identities were associated more with their adornment than with their gender.
